Nguni Languages: A Rich Tapestry of Heritage

The Nguni languages form a vibrant family of linguistic traditions spoken across Southeastern Africa. Rooted in the heart of this region, these tongues have been shaped by centuries of cultural interaction, resulting in a diverse linguistic landscape. From , Xhosa to Swati, , each Nguni language possesses its own unique inflections, grammar, and vocabulary, yet they are all get more info bound together by a common ancestor.

Appreciating the Nguni languages is to embark on a world of storytelling. These intricate structures mirror the rich history, beliefs, and values of the Nguni people. , Moreover, their persistent use today serves as a powerful testament to the resilience of cultural heritage in an ever-changing world.
